❓ Dr. Thomas asks the Treasurer about project cost overruns reported by government agencies, requesting details on specific projects, cost variances, and original budgets. The Treasurer's response refers to submissions considered by the Expenditure Review Committee and Cabinet, with details supposedly available in Budget or Mid-year Review publications.
